How Can Behavioral Design Enhance Sonic Birthday Party Decorations?

While many decorators prioritize visual themes, I’ve discovered that the arrangement and grouping of Sonic elements (like rings, checkered patterns, and speed motifs) can significantly shape children's behavior and engagement levels. Studies indicate that establishing intentional zones—action, refreshments, relaxation—keeps young guests occupied (NAHB, 2022). Based on my design experience, utilizing Sonic props as 'boundary indicators' effectively differentiates areas meant for lively games from those designated for quieter activities.

What Are the Hidden Downsides of Excessive Sonic Decor?

Contrary to common belief, adding more décor does not always equate to better. An overabundance of Sonic birthday party decorations can lead to sensory overload—intense colors, loud patterns, and repetitive imagery might overwhelm some children and diminish their playtime. A 2023 Statista report reveals that parents are increasingly prioritizing psychological comfort over mere visual stimulation. My method goes further by striking a balance between energetic and tranquil zones for all attendees.

How Can You Create Interactive Zones That Foster Play?

Most Sonic party arrangements are limited to themed tables; however, behavioral design invites richer interactions. My findings indicate that clustering decorations—like positioning Sonic 'rings' as hopscotch indicators, or employing plush Chaos Emeralds for team activities—encourages collective movement and shared enjoyment. Is There a Data-Driven Strategy for Sonic Party Color Schemes?

While blue and yellow are predominant in Sonic party décor, data suggests that incorporating red highlights increases energy and visual contrast without overwhelming guests (ArchDaily, 2023). Unlike other guides that overlook neurodiversity, I propose using a layering technique—melding vivid centerpiece colors with softer background hues to minimize overstimulation.

How Can Parents Balance Their Budget with Engaging Decor?

Although market guides often recommend costly licensed products, I've observed that DIY Sonic birthday decorations—utilizing printable designs, felt crafts, and recycled toys—offer as much joy at a lower price. For instance, assembling a distinctive 'Sonic speed zone' using blue streamers and ring cutouts can yield high impact without excessive spending. Data indicates families can save up to 35% by opting for customizable decorations, as reported by Houzz.

What Spatial Planning Issues Hinder Enjoyment at Sonic Parties?

Typical Sonic setups frequently create traffic congestions near food tables. However, findings reveal that parties featuring clear entryways, activity, and relaxation zones enhance guest flow and satisfaction (NAHB, 2022). Based on my observations, incorporating a 'parent chill area' away from the activity chaos is critical for effective Sonic birthday party decoration. How Can Sensory-Friendly Decor Welcome All Children?

Numerous Sonic decorations fail to engage children with sensory sensitivities. Unlike many guides, I advocate for the inclusion of soft textures, visual breaks, and adjustable lighting, fostering a more inclusive atmosphere. Designer Emily Carter highlights on Houzz that adapting zones enhances comfort for all kids, especially in highly stimulating settings.
